Manitoba to curtail minimum wage hikes?


CRFA’s Dwayne Marling discussed the province’s labour issues with Minister of Labour Jennifer Howard in on July 25, 2012.

(Aug. 14/12) Manitoba may embrace a more positive approach to minimum wage increases.

What Minister Howard said
Minister Howard was open to establishing a new methodology for consultation on minimum wage changes. Although she reinforced her intention to raise the province’s minimum wage annually, she acknowledged the wage rate may well have caught up to the appropriate level. Minister Howard noted that government would no longer look to make future increases significantly higher than the rate of inflation.

Labour shortage on the table
CRFA also discussed Manitoba’s existing labour shortage in the foodservice industry, and the expected growth in these shortages over the next few years.
